Job Summary

Provide housing and support to youth in a housing setting, serving as the primary day contact for youth, supporting to settle, manage stressors and potential crises, and helping clients focus on daily goals within a holistic wraparound care team. Position emphasizes working with at-risk youth involved with MCFD, in a 10-hour shift schedule (1:30pm–11:30pm) and requires a relevant bachelor’s degree (Social Work or Child & Youth Care) plus 1-2 years of experience with vulnerable populations; ASIST/NVCI training are assets. Responsibilities include facilitating programming, supporting mental health, life skills, community supports, and adherence to organizational policies, with duties potentially relocated temporarily as needed and requiring Emergency First Aid, Food Safe, immunization records, and Criminal Record Check.

Required Qualifications

  • A relevant bachelor's degree, such as Social Work or Child & Youth Care
  • Minimum of 1-2 years' experience working with vulnerable populations and at-risk youth
  • Experience facilitating programming is an asset
  • ASIST training and NVCI training is an asset
